Business
STMicroelectronics N.V. (STM.MI) designs, develops, manufactures and markets semiconductor integrated circuits and discrete components for a wide range of applications including automotive, industrial, personal electronics, communications equipment and computers. The company offers microcontrollers under the STM8 and STM32 families; application-specific analog, power management and battery management system ICs; sensors such as touch, motion, environmental, magnetic and MEMS; RF products including cellular modems, short-range wireless connectivity and automotive radar; custom ASICs and system-on-chips; and silicon carbide power devices for electrification. It also provides edge AI and computer vision solutions, digital signal processors, automotive MCUs and microcontrollers, and LoRa connectivity devices; operates through three segments: Automotive and Discrete Group (ADG), Analog, MEMS and Sensors Group (AMS), and Microcontrollers and Digital ICs Group (MDG). STMicroelectronics N.V. was founded in 1987 through the merger of SGS Microelettronica and Thomson Semiconducteurs and is headquartered in Geneva, Switzerland, with principal manufacturing facilities in Europe, the United States and Asia, serving customers worldwide across automotive, industrial, cloud computing, mobile, telecom and consumer markets. The company maintains global operations with design centers and sales offices in more than 40 countries and generates significant revenue from Europe, the Americas and Greater China/Asia Pacific regions. It has no major parent company but collaborates extensively with strategic partners in the semiconductor ecosystem.
